MADISON, WI—December 2, 2005—NimbleGen Systems Inc. announced today it has raised
$8.2 million in a private venture financing round led by Cargill Ventures and Skyline Ventures.
NimbleGen, the leading provider of flexible high-density microarray products and services for
genetic analysis, has raised a total of $50 million since its inception in 1999. The company will
use the new funding to finance its rapid expansion as it works to enable High-Definition
GenomicsSM, which provides researchers enhanced detail of information concerning genetic
variation, and clarity of complex data sets.

All of the company’s existing venture capital and institutional investors participated in the round,
including Cargill Ventures, Skyline Ventures, Baird Venture Partners, the State of Wisconsin
Investment Board, Tactics II Investments LLC, Topspin Partners, Venture Investors LLC, and The
Wisconsin Alumni Research Foundation (WARF).

NimbleGen Systems Inc.
NimbleGen Systems, the leading supplier of flexible high-density microarray products and services, is
enabling a new era of "High- Definition Genomics." NimbleGen uniquely produces high-density arrays of
isothermal long oligos that provide superior results for advanced genomic analysis methods such as CGH,
ChIP, microbial whole-genome resequencing and expression tiling. NimbleGen's High-Definition Genomics
enables scientists to obtain and integrate complex genetic data sets not previously accessible, providing a
much clearer understanding of genomics and systems biology. This improved performance is made possible
by NimbleGen's Maskless Array Synthesis (MAS) technology, which uses digital light processing and rapid,
high-yield photochemistry to synthesize DNA.
